Ordenacion

ivanchi69
23 de Noviembre del 2009
Buenas estoy intentando hacer una ordenacion y que me guarde la posicion inicial de los valores y queria saber donde tengo que poner la sentencia para que me guarde la posicion de cada valor en un array posicion[SIZE] (osea posicion[7])

salu2 y gracias

SIZE es 7

for(i=0;i<SIZE;i++)
{
for(j=i+1,minimo=i;j<SIZE;j++)
if(numeros[j]<numeros[minimo])
minimo=j;
x=numeros[i];
numeros[i]=numeros[minimo];
numeros[minimo]=x;
printf("%d,",numeros[i]);

}